We spent the morning exploring the Valley of Fire state park. Thanks Jamie for the recommendation! What an awesome place. It is the first state park in Nevada about a 1 hour drive from Vegas. The landscape and views were fantastic. We remarked how we couldn’t believe this was in the US. It is a 42,000 acre park with scenic drives through the canyons, hiking trails, picnic areas and camping. We didn’t do much hiking because it was really hot and we weren’t prepared. We planned to grab a quick breakfast at Mc Donald’s on the way but there but there was really no where to get anything once we left the city. Fail! We grabbed a snack at the visitors center once it opened. We will definitely come back in cooler weather to get some hiking in. We saw some wildlife – a big horned sheep, a roadrunner and a few other birds. We didn’t get a glimpse of any coyote or fox (but did get a photo from the visitors center). I highly recommend the drive out to Valley of Fire if you’re ever in Vegas. The pictures can’t capture the vastness but give you and idea. Just breathtaking!
